Why Heart Rate Matters

First off, why is heart rate so crucial in newborns? Well, the heart rate is a key indicator of how well a newborn is doing, especially during resuscitation. A normal heart rate signifies good blood flow and oxygen delivery throughout the body, while an abnormal heart rate can signal distress—something you definitely want to sort out quickly.

The Preferred Method: Stethoscope and Monitoring Devices

So, what’s the best way to measure a newborn's heart rate during resuscitation? The gold standard revolves around using a stethoscope or a monitoring device—let’s unpack that.

Using a stethoscope offers the kind of auditory feedback that can really make a difference. You listen for the heartbeat directly and, in a way, tune into what’s happening inside. It’s like being a musician, attuned to the rhythm of a heartbeat, helping providers pinpoint whether it’s racing or perhaps slower than it should be.

On the flip side, monitoring devices like electrocardiograms (ECGs) or pulse oximeters take it up a notch. They provide continuous and precise heart rate readings, offering invaluable information in the heat of the moment. Why Other Methods Fall Short

Now, you might wonder about the other methods for assessing heart rate. Let’s take a peek at a couple:

  • Listening for Heart Sounds with the Ear: While this might sound straightforward, it’s not practical in a high-stress, often noisy environment like a delivery room. You could be straining to hear something amid the bustle, which is never ideal when it comes to newborn health.

  • Counting Pulses at the Wrist: This can be tough with a newborn’s tiny wrist, not to mention that the pulse might not be as easily palpable. You wouldn’t want to miss a crucial heartbeat because you’re fidgeting with trying to find a pulse that’s just too elusive.

  • Observing Color Changes in the Skin: While you might notice some color changes indicating a lack of perfusion, such an observation doesn’t provide the direct heart rate reading that’s essential for determining the need for resuscitative efforts.
